Types of Employment Drug Screening Services

Employment drug screening services offer various testing scenarios tailored to different business needs and circumstances. Each type serves a specific purpose in maintaining a drug-free environment.

  • Pre-employment Screening: Conducted before an applicant is hired, this is designed to screen out candidates who may pose a risk due to substance abuse. It’s a foundational step in many hiring processes.
  • Random Screening: Unscheduled and unannounced testing of a randomly selected percentage of employees. This type of employment drug screening service acts as a deterrent and helps ensure ongoing compliance.
  • Post-accident Screening: Performed after an employee is involved in a workplace accident or incident. The goal is to determine if drug use was a contributing factor.
  • Reasonable Suspicion Screening: Initiated when a supervisor observes specific behaviors or physical symptoms that indicate an employee may be under the influence of drugs. This requires careful documentation.
  • Return-to-Duty and Follow-up Screening: Required for employees who have violated a drug policy and are returning to work, often followed by unannounced follow-up tests over a specified period.

Common Drug Testing Methods

Professional employment drug screening services utilize several reliable methods to detect the presence of illicit substances. Each method has its own advantages in terms of detection window, invasiveness, and cost.

Urine Testing

Urine testing is the most common and widely accepted method for employment drug screening services. It is non-invasive, cost-effective, and can detect recent drug use for several days after ingestion, depending on the substance. This method is often preferred for its versatility.

Hair Follicle Testing

Hair follicle testing offers a longer detection window, typically up to 90 days, making it excellent for identifying habitual drug use. While more expensive than urine tests, it provides a comprehensive historical view of an individual’s drug use patterns. Many employment drug screening services offer this option for specific roles.

Oral Fluid (Saliva) Testing

Oral fluid testing is a less invasive option that can detect very recent drug use, often within minutes to hours of ingestion, and up to a few days. It’s easy to administer and observe, reducing the chances of tampering. This method is gaining popularity among employment drug screening services.

Blood Testing

Blood testing is the most accurate method for determining the presence of drugs in an individual’s system at the exact time of the test. However, it is more invasive and has a shorter detection window, making it less common for routine employment drug screening services but valuable in specific situations.

Implementing a Drug-Free Workplace Policy

Effective employment drug screening services are most successful when integrated into a clear and comprehensive drug-free workplace policy. This policy outlines expectations and consequences for employees.

Policy Development

Develop a clear, written policy that outlines the company’s stance on drugs, the types of testing that will occur, and the consequences of a positive test. Legal counsel should review this document. A well-defined policy is the backbone of successful employment drug screening services.

Employee Education

Educate all employees about the drug-free workplace policy, including the reasons for drug testing and the procedures involved. Transparency builds trust and understanding. Employees should be fully aware of the role of employment drug screening services.

Confidentiality

Ensure that all drug test results and related information are handled with the utmost confidentiality, adhering to privacy regulations. Protecting employee information is critical.

Legal Considerations

Be aware of state and federal laws regarding drug testing, including employee rights and reasonable accommodation. Compliance with these laws is crucial for the legal defensibility of your employment drug screening services program.
